Video Sigmoidoscope Market Regional Analysis, Demand Analysis and Competitive Outlook 2025-2032

Market Overview

MARKET INSIGHTS

Global Video Sigmoidoscope market was valued at USD 423.7 million in 2024 and is projected to reach USD 612.5 million by 2032, exhibiting a CAGR of 4.7% during the forecast period.

A Video Sigmoidoscope is a flexible, lighted endoscope equipped with a miniature video camera at its tip, designed specifically for the visual examination of the sigmoid colon and rectum. This advanced medical device transmits high-definition images to a monitor, providing clinicians with a clear, magnified view of the intestinal mucosa to diagnose conditions such as colorectal cancer, polyps, and inflammatory bowel disease. The procedure, known as sigmoidoscopy, is a minimally invasive diagnostic tool that offers a significant improvement over traditional fiber-optic scopes because of its superior imaging and documentation capabilities.

MARKET DRIVERS


Rising Prevalence of Colorectal Diseases

The growing global incidence of colorectal cancer, inflammatory bowel disease, and other lower gastrointestinal disorders is a primary driver. Early detection is critical for improving patient outcomes, and video sigmoidoscopy serves as a vital, minimally invasive diagnostic tool. This has led to increased screening recommendations and procedure volumes worldwide.

Technological Advancements in Endoscopic Imaging

Significant improvements in high-definition imaging, narrower scopes for patient comfort, and enhanced portability are making video sigmoidoscopes more effective and accessible. Integration with advanced features like narrow-band imaging (NBI) and digital recording capabilities improves diagnostic accuracy and supports telemedicine applications.

The shift towards minimally invasive procedures in outpatient settings is reducing hospital stays and associated costs, further propelling market adoption.

Furthermore, supportive government initiatives and awareness campaigns promoting colorectal cancer screening are creating a favorable environment for market growth, particularly in developed economies.

MARKET CHALLENGES


High Cost of Advanced Equipment and Maintenance

The initial capital investment for high-definition video sigmoidoscopy systems is substantial. Additionally, the ongoing costs for reprocessing equipment, repairs, and disposable accessories can be a significant financial burden for smaller clinics and facilities in developing regions, limiting their adoption rates.

Other Challenges

Reimbursement and Regulatory Hurdles
Variations in reimbursement policies for diagnostic procedures across different healthcare systems can create uncertainty for providers. Navigating complex regulatory pathways for new device approvals also presents a challenge for manufacturers, potentially delaying market entry.

Requirement for Skilled Professionals
Effective utilization of video sigmoidoscopes requires specialized training for gastroenterologists and endoscopy nurses. A shortage of adequately trained personnel in certain geographic areas can act as a barrier to the widespread use of this technology.

MARKET RESTRAINTS


Patient Apprehension and Discomfort

Despite being minimally invasive, the procedure can cause patient anxiety and physical discomfort, which may lead to avoidance of recommended screenings. This psychological barrier remains a significant restraint, impacting procedure volumes even when medical necessity is high.

Competition from Alternative Diagnostic Methods

Video sigmoidoscopy faces competition from other screening modalities, such as fecal immunochemical tests (FIT) and CT colonography, which are less invasive. While these alternatives may have different diagnostic capabilities, their non-invasive nature makes them more acceptable to some patient populations.

Economic downturns and budget constraints within healthcare systems can also lead to deferred capital expenditures on new medical equipment, including video sigmoidoscopes, thereby restraining market growth in the short to medium term.

MARKET OPPORTUNITIES


Expansion in Emerging Markets

There is significant untapped potential in emerging economies across Asia-Pacific, Latin America, and the Middle East. Improving healthcare infrastructure, rising healthcare expenditure, and growing awareness of gastrointestinal health present substantial growth opportunities for market penetration.

Development of Disposable Sigmoidoscopes

The development and increasing adoption of single-use, disposable video sigmoidoscopes address critical challenges of cross-contamination and high reprocessing costs. This innovation represents a major growth vector, particularly in settings where infection control is a top priority.

Furthermore, the integration of artificial intelligence (AI) for real-time polyp detection and characterization during procedures can enhance diagnostic precision, reduce operator dependency, and create new value propositions, opening up advanced market segments.

Regional Analysis: Video Sigmoidoscope Market
North America
North America firmly leads the global video sigmoidoscope market, driven by its sophisticated healthcare infrastructure and high adoption rates of advanced medical technologies. The region benefits from extensive awareness of colorectal cancer screening, with screening guidelines widely promoted by major medical associations. Strong reimbursement frameworks from both public and private insurers support the procurement of high-end video sigmoidoscope systems. Additionally, a concentration of key market players and research institutions in the United States and Canada fosters continuous innovation and early adoption of enhancements like high-definition imaging and improved ergonomics. High patient volumes in well-equipped ambulatory surgical centers and hospitals further sustain market growth. The presence of a large aging population susceptible to colorectal conditions underpins consistent demand, while competitive market dynamics encourage the development of cost-effective and user-friendly devices tailored to diverse clinical settings.
Advanced Healthcare Infrastructure
North America's market strength is underpinned by state-of-the-art healthcare facilities equipped with the latest endoscopic technologies. Hospitals and specialized clinics prioritize investments in digital imaging systems, supporting the use of video sigmoidoscopes for both diagnostic and therapeutic procedures. This infrastructure facilitates seamless integration with electronic health records and telemedicine platforms.
Favorable Reimbursement Policies
Robust insurance coverage for colorectal screenings and diagnostic procedures significantly lowers financial barriers for patients and healthcare providers. Clear reimbursement codes for video sigmoidoscopy encourage its adoption over traditional methods. This financial support system ensures steady utilization rates and drives market volume for device manufacturers and service providers.
High Disease Awareness
Extensive public health campaigns and educational initiatives led by organizations have successfully raised awareness about colorectal cancer risks and the importance of early detection. This cultural emphasis on preventive care creates a sustained demand for screening tools like video sigmoidoscopes, making them a standard component of routine health checks for at-risk populations.
Strong Presence of Market Leaders
The region hosts the headquarters and major research centers of leading global medical device companies specializing in endoscopy. This proximity fosters close collaboration with clinicians, driving product innovation focused on improving image clarity, device portability, and patient comfort. Continuous R&D investments ensure that the latest technological advancements are quickly commercialized.

Europe
Europe represents a mature and significant market for video sigmoidoscopes, characterized by well-established healthcare systems and universal health coverage models in many countries. Stringent regulatory standards ensure high device quality and patient safety, fostering trust among medical practitioners. There is a growing emphasis on minimally invasive diagnostic procedures, supported by favorable government initiatives for cancer screening programs. However, market growth is moderated by budget constraints within public healthcare systems, which can slow the adoption of the latest high-cost systems. Manufacturers are responding by developing value-based products that meet clinical needs while addressing cost-effectiveness. The region also shows a trend towards the standardization of endoscopic procedures and training, ensuring consistent quality of care.

Asia-Pacific
The Asia-Pacific region is experiencing the fastest growth in the video sigmoidoscope market, driven by rapidly improving healthcare infrastructure, rising healthcare expenditures, and increasing awareness of gastrointestinal diseases. Emerging economies are investing heavily in modernizing their hospital systems, creating new demand for advanced endoscopic equipment. A large patient base and growing middle class with access to private healthcare are key growth drivers. However, market penetration faces challenges, including the high cost of advanced devices and varying levels of healthcare access between urban and rural areas. Local manufacturers are gaining traction by offering more affordable alternatives, while international players are adapting their strategies through partnerships and localized product offerings to cater to diverse market needs.

South America
The video sigmoidoscope market in South America is developing, with growth primarily concentrated in major urban centers and private healthcare sectors. Economic volatility and disparities in healthcare access pose significant challenges to widespread adoption. Brazil and Argentina are the most active markets, where increasing investments in specialty clinics are driving demand. The region shows potential for growth as public health initiatives gradually expand to include more comprehensive cancer screening programs. Market development is reliant on economic stability and increased government healthcare spending to improve infrastructure and medical training for endoscopic procedures.

Middle East & Africa
The Middle East & Africa region presents a heterogeneous market for video sigmoidoscopes, with significant variation between the high-income Gulf Cooperation Council countries and other developing nations. Wealthier nations boast advanced medical facilities that readily adopt the latest endoscopic technologies, often driven by medical tourism. In contrast, broader regional adoption is hindered by limited healthcare infrastructure, budget constraints, and a focus on more basic healthcare needs. International aid and development programs are helping to build capacity, but market growth remains nascent and uneven. The long-term potential is tied to economic development and increased prioritization of non-communicable disease screening in public health agendas.
